Section 4.2: Hepatitis B & Bloodborne Pathogen Protocols

Key Takeaways

  • Patients who are Hepatitis B surface antigen (HBsAg) positive must be dialyzed in a separate isolation room using a dedicated machine.
  • Staff caring for HBsAg-positive patients must not care for HBV-susceptible patients during the same shift.
  • All dialysis patients should be routinely tested for HBsAg and anti-HBs to monitor infection status and immunity.
  • Standard precautions apply to all patients, treating all blood and body fluids as potentially infectious for HIV, HCV, and HBV.

Hepatitis B & Bloodborne Pathogen Protocols

Hemodialysis patients face a heightened risk of exposure to bloodborne pathogens, most notably Hepatitis B Virus (HBV), Hepatitis C Virus (HCV), and Human Immunodeficiency Virus (HIV). Because treatments involve extracorporeal blood circuits, large-gauge needles, and frequent vascular access interventions, the potential for blood exposure is ever-present. Among these pathogens, Hepatitis B is particularly resilient and transmissible in the environment, prompting the CDC to mandate highly specific isolation protocols that every dialysis technologist must rigorously follow.

Hepatitis B: The Rationale for Strict Isolation

Hepatitis B is highly infectious; it can be transmitted through microscopic, invisible droplets of blood and can survive on environmental surfaces (such as machine panels, clamps, and chairs) for at least seven days. Unlike HCV and HIV, which require more direct blood-to-blood contact and degrade more quickly outside the body, HBV's environmental stability makes cross-contamination via shared equipment or staff hands a major vector for outbreaks in dialysis units.

To manage this risk, dialysis facilities monitor patients' HBV status using two primary blood tests:

  1. Hepatitis B surface antigen (HBsAg): A positive result indicates that the patient currently has an active HBV infection and is infectious to others.
  2. Hepatitis B surface antibody (anti-HBs): A positive result (usually >10 mIU/mL) indicates that the patient has immunity to HBV, either from prior resolved infection or successful vaccination.

Protocols for HBsAg-Positive Patients

When a patient tests positive for HBsAg, the facility must immediately implement strict isolation protocols to protect susceptible patients and staff.

1. Dedicated Isolation Room: The CDC mandates that HBsAg-positive patients must be dialyzed in a separate isolation room. This room must have a door that closes and separate designated clean and dirty areas. The isolation room acts as a physical barrier to prevent the spread of the virus to the general treatment floor.

2. Dedicated Machine and Equipment: The dialysis machine used for an HBsAg-positive patient must be dedicated solely to that patient (or other HBsAg-positive patients). It cannot be used for HBV-susceptible patients. Additionally, all non-disposable equipment, such as blood pressure cuffs, stethoscopes, and tourniquets, must be dedicated exclusively to the isolation room and not shared with the general patient population.

3. Dedicated Staffing: Staff assignments are a critical component of HBV isolation. A technician or nurse assigned to care for an HBsAg-positive patient during a shift must NOT care for HBV-susceptible patients at the same time. While it is acceptable for the staff member to care for HBV-immune patients concurrently (those with positive anti-HBs), they are strictly prohibited from crossing over to care for susceptible patients due to the high risk of cross-contamination via contaminated hands or clothing.

Hepatitis C and HIV Management

While Hepatitis B requires physical isolation rooms, Hepatitis C (HCV) and HIV do not require the same level of environmental separation. However, they demand unwavering adherence to Standard Precautions.

For patients with HCV or HIV, the CDC states that they can be dialyzed in the general treatment area. Dedicated machines or isolation rooms are not required. The transmission of HCV and HIV in dialysis units is almost exclusively linked to breaks in standard infection control practices, particularly cross-contamination through shared medication vials, improper hand hygiene, or inadequate cleaning of shared environmental surfaces.

Therefore, the primary defense against HCV and HIV transmission is the strict execution of routine infection control measures:

  • Meticulous Hand Hygiene: Changing gloves and washing hands between every patient contact and after touching any potentially contaminated surface.
  • Safe Injection Practices: Never sharing multi-dose medication vials between patients if the vial has been brought into the treatment area. Medications should ideally be prepared in a centralized clean room.
  • Thorough Environmental Cleaning: Adhering to the required contact times for EPA-registered disinfectants on the dialysis machine and station surfaces.

Vaccination and Routine Screening

Prevention is the ultimate goal. All susceptible dialysis patients and staff should be offered the Hepatitis B vaccine series. Following vaccination, patients are tested for anti-HBs to confirm immunity.

Routine serological screening is a cornerstone of dialysis infection control. Susceptible patients are typically tested monthly for HBsAg to catch any new infections immediately. Patients with confirmed immunity are tested less frequently (e.g., annually). Routine screening for HCV antibodies (anti-HCV) is also conducted, usually upon admission and semi-annually thereafter, to identify any seroconversions that would indicate a breakdown in facility infection control practices.

Isolation Requirements by Bloodborne Pathogen

PathogenIsolation RoomDedicated MachineStaffing Restrictions
Hepatitis B (HBV)Required for HBsAg+RequiredCannot care for susceptible patients simultaneously
Hepatitis C (HCV)Not RequiredNot RequiredStandard Precautions only
HIVNot RequiredNot RequiredStandard Precautions only
